Lunch for Gillani disallowed

Published August 28, 2006

RAWALPINDI, Aug 27: Adiala Jail Superintendent Tariq Babar disallowed the lunch brought by visitors for former National Assembly speaker Syed Yousaf Raza Gillani here on Saturday.

In a press release the jail superintendent’s behaviour towards Mr Gillani has been defined as quite pugnacious and inhuman. He has been accused of always ridiculing the PPP leader and his visitors.

It is pertinent to mention here that two jail doctors refused to work under the jail superintendent due to his vituperative and notorious conduct and they declared Mr Babar an insane person, the press release said.—Online
